OL wasn't as bad as I thought on the rewatch. Majors and Okafor need to be benched though. Both were flat out missing assignments and getting beat. Majors really bad. Jones might be better with a better guard next to him. Card has to know when Arky is dropping 8 if no one is open he either needs to run or check it down. WRs were open but Card was dropping his eyes too much and late on reads. Deep ball was also there and Card either didn't let it fly or couldn't connect. Casey came into the game and was much more comfortable and decisive. He needs to start or he may not wait until the end of the season to transfer and Sark might lose the locker room. Whittington had a really bad game. On defense I have no idea why we didn't stack the box and force Jefferson to beat us with his arm. Majority of the time we had 6 in the box, that wasn't going to get done. We also missed a ton of tackles.

Bijan knows.


“I thought [Thompson] showed a lot of poise and calm in the pocket, delivered the ball down the field,” he said. “So all those things add up to, ‘hey this guy deserves his chance’, and I feel good about it.”

Running back Bijan Robinson said Thompson’s experience is crucial and that he brought a level of composure that Card lacked against Arkansas

“With [Thompson], I know he has a little more experience than [Card], and he can make some reads or make some calls that he might have seen you know before, as he’s been here,” Robinson said. “When [Thompson] got in there, he looked really calm. Nothing really rattled him, nothing really fazed him. He just looked comfortable in the pocket and made the right reads, even when he had to tuck it and run, he still looked confident when he was doing that.”


As for the future, Robinson is happy for Thompson and believes the team needs to rally behind him.

“I am happy for Casey,” he said. “I just know that we just need to execute and ride with [Thompson] moving forward.”
